Finance, Personal

How to Make Money Blogging in Canada in 5 Ways (2022 Guide)

Blogging is one of the lucrative digital marketing ideas because of the multiple earning opportunities it provides.

Depending on your availability, you can blog as a side hustle or replace your 9-5 job with blogging.

Unfortunately, not every blogger knows how to make money out of it. Thousands of blogs have disappeared as a result of not generating a dime.

So if you want to venture into blogging, you need to know your left and right to make the most of your time.

In this article, I will walk you through five simple ways on how to make money blogging in Canada.

Let’s get started!

How to Make Money Blogging in Canada

How to Start a Blog in Canada

In case you don’t have a blog, you need to have one before you think of making money out of it. 

But if you already have a blog, you should jump to the next section to learn how to make money blogging in Canada.

Starting a blog is easier than making money from blogging. This is because there are already established step-by-step processes on how to create a blog.

Let’s go through them below: 

1. Determine Your Niche 

The blogging industry is categorized into different niches or areas. The niches cut across almost all the industries you can think of. This includes:

  • Entertainment
  • Lifestyle
  • Health and Fitness
  • Sport
  • Fashion
  • Nutrition
  • Marketing
  • Finance and Business
  • Technology
  • Education
  • And so on

With different niches to choose from, your best bet is to choose a niche that suits your passion, interest or expertise.

That way, you can easily provide your audience with high-quality content without running out of ideas.

By choosing a niche you have expertise in, you will easily attract public trust and search engines will reward you with higher visibility. In return, you will get high traffic and more earnings.

Note: Some niches are more profitable than others. But when choosing a niche, your passion, interest and expertise should come first. 

2. Chose a Domain Name

A domain name is the address of your blog. It goes like this:, or, and so on.

However, there are many things you need to consider when choosing a domain name. 

Except if you’re using your name as the domain name, you should make your domain name reflective of your blog purpose. 

For example, the domain name, easily indicates that the blog is about finance in Canada. And indicates a blog about real estate matters.

By having a reflective domain name, potential users can know from a distance what to expect when they visit your blog.

Other factors you need to consider when choosing a domain name are highlighted below:

  • Make it short
  • Make it memorable
  • It should be unique (not registered elsewhere)

However, your desired domain name may be already registered by someone. Oh yes, there are over 350 million domains registered worldwide.

If your desired domain name is already registered, you have to use a variation of the domain name eg. instead of

Alternatively, you should choose a different domain name as suggested by your hosting provider.

3. Choose a Blogging Platform

A blogging platform is what determines the appearance and functionality of your blog. Some of the popular blogging platforms include:

  • WordPress
  • Blogger
  • Wix
  • Shopify
  • Tumblr

However, WordPress is seen as the overall best blogging platform due to its flexibility and thousands of plugins that simplify the entire blogging process. Little wonder the platform hosts over 40% of the world’s blogs.

It’s worth noting that most blogging platforms allow you to build a free blog with them by using a generic domain name. For example:

  • at WordPress
  • at Blogger
  • at Tumblr

Bear in mind that using a free blogging platform will not give you the optimal result. It will restrict your traffic, and limit your customization and earning potential.

To make the most of your blogging experience, consider using a paid domain name which is accessible through your hosting provider. 

4. Choose a Hosting Provider 

A hosting provider is a platform that makes your blog accessible to the world wide web. As a result, it’s essential to choose a hosting provider that:

  • Loads pages faster
  • Makes your blog accessible all the time
  • Protects your blog from hackers
  • Provides excellent customer support

If you ask most bloggers which hosting provider meets the above conditions, many will mention Bluehost.

In addition to the above benefits, Bluehost also provides a free domain name in your first year with it. 

With WordPress built-in, free SSL certificate, free custom email, 24/7 customer support, and so many other benefits, it is obvious why Bluehost hosts over 2 million websites in the world.

5. Install Theme and Plugins

Upon signing up with a hosting provider, the next step is to start designing your blog. The process is straightforward but you can request the help of a web developer if you want a professional-looking blog.

The first step of the design process is choosing a theme. You should choose a theme that supports your niche and taste.

After installing and customizing the theme, you can now install relevant plugins that can ease your work.

The beauty of using WordPress is that you have hundreds of free plugins to choose from. However, you must be careful not to install every plugin as that can affect the speed of your blog.

The relevant plugins you want to install include:

  • GenerateBlocks – for writing
  • Jetpack – for backup and protection
  • Yoast SEO – for content and SEO optimization 
  • Easy of Tables – for a table of contents
  • Site Skit by Google – For understanding the performance of your blog under Google Search Console and Google Analytics

To give your blog a professional outlook, you should create the following pages when designing the blog:

  • About us
  • Contact us
  • Disclaimer
  • Privacy policy

Once you’re done with the design, you disclose it to the general public by making it live.

6. Start Writing 

Now that your blog is live, it’s time to start writing content to attract traffic.

Writing is the core part of any successful blog. The quality of the content you produce can determine the success or failure of your blog.

As such, you should be committed to publishing only high-quality content that provides value to your audience. 

It doesn’t matter the frequency. Whether you’re publishing one content per day, or once per week, you will still attract traffic so long you produce quality content.

The blogging industry is already saturated with people that are just after the $ without minding the end user. As such, in virtually every niche, there is low-quality content to beat.

By filling the gap with high-quality content, you will be rewarded with high ranking by search engines and people will find your blog valuable and share it with others.

But what is high-quality content? In addition to offering additional value beyond what’s available on the Internet, a high-quality content is:

  • Unique
  • Readable
  • Grammatically sound
  • Comprehensive
  • Plagiarism-free

Pro Tip: Writing high-quality content is not enough. You should utilize SEO strategies to maximize your blog traffic on Google and other search engines.

How to Make Money Blogging In Canada

It’s time to start enjoying the dividends of your labour. 

The fortunate thing is that there are countless ways to make money blogging in Canada.

However, not all monetization methods provide the same earnings. As such, it’s essential to prioritize those methods with the highest earning potential.

Here we are going to look at the top five major ways you can start making money from your blog from the day you start publishing content.

Let’s go there.

1. Sell Your Services

From the inception, the easiest way to start making money from blogging is by selling your services.

This is because your blog hasn’t generated enough traffic to qualify for Google Ads or other monetization methods.

By showcasing your services on your blog, you will get global exposure, increasing your earning potential.

From online courses, freelancing, and selling e-books to consultation, there are many services you can offer through your blog. You can even use some of the 15 legit ways to make money fast in Canada on your blog.

In the beginning, you may find it challenging to sell your services through your blog due to limited traffic.

To get quick traffic, consider sharing your content across different channels, social media platforms, forums and so on.

If you like, you can also monetize some of your content by making them available only on paid membership. However, the content must be unique enough to get people to pay for it as there are free alternatives out there.

2. Affiliate Marketing

Affiliate marketing is another method Canadian bloggers are using to make money. This method also works for new blogs with limited traffic.

With affiliate marketing, all you need is to recommend or showcase the products and services of third-party companies on your websites.

In exchange, you will get rewarded with a commission on every successful sale from your referrals.

How much you make on affiliate marketing depends on the product or services you recommend and the volume of conversion generated from your referrals.

As a new blog, you may find it challenging to earn through affiliate marketing due to limited traffic. But distributing your content across social media will help generate traffic to your blog, making it easier to attract referrals.

3. Advertisement

This is the popular option bloggers are using to make money worldwide. By using this method, you will make money by allowing third-party companies to advertise their products and services on your blog.

Some of the biggest advertising companies include Google Adsense, Mediavine and Ezoic. Companies pay these advertisers to advise their products and services through blogs and other platforms. 

For each successful sale that was generated through your blog, the ads company pays a fixed amount depending on the product or service sold.

Note that advertisement companies have different traffic requirements. But Google Adsense tends to be more flexible as it doesn’t require specific traffic volume to qualify. 

While ads can help you earn higher, they can reduce your blog speed. As such, you should always optimize your blog when using ads.

4. Sponsored Posts

Instead of advertising their products or services on your blog, some companies prefer to have you write content about their products and services.

This will help generate public trust and help the target clients make informed decisions. 

In turn, the companies will pay you for writing about their products or services on your blog.

However, your blog must generate significant traffic to start receiving sponsored post requests. As a result, this method may not be suitable for beginner bloggers. 

Note: When you start receiving sponsored post requests, you should be careful of the kind of product or service you promote. Promoting bad products can easily ruin your reputation.

5. Guest Posting

Due to the increasing relevance of link building, many bloggers use guest posting to earn backlinks to their blogs. 

  • A backlink simply refers to a link from another website pointing to your website. The more quality backlinks you have, the more your domain authority increases. And the higher your domain authority, the easier you can rank high on search engines.

When your blog starts generating significant traffic, you will get guest posting requests from other bloggers in your niche. 

While some bloggers charge a fee for accepting guest posts on their blogs, others accept the request for free. You have the final say on whether to charge a fee or not.

However, how much you charge on guest posts should depend on your domain authority. You will naturally charge higher as your blog domain authority increases.

Note: You may be penalized by search engines when you focus more on providing backlinks service.

How to Maximize Your Blog Earnings in Canada

The essence of blogging is to demonstrate your passion with like-minded people. Money is just the reward for that.

Currently, the blogging industry is saturated with bloggers that are just after making money. If you’re one of them, sorry, you will not go far. 

This is because blogging is not a get-rich-quick scheme. As such, you can’t stand the test of time if you’re just after money.

Based on practical experience, I recommend the following tips for maximizing your earnings while blogging in Canada.

  • Focus on providing your audience with high-quality content at all times
  • Avoid building backlinks from low-quality or spammy websites
  • Don’t over-monetize your blog by placing ads at unnatural positions 
  • Be consistent 
  • Have patience (it’s not going to be easy at the beginning. The popular proverb:”the patient dog eats the fattest bone” also applies here).

The Bottom Line

As digital marketing is growing, many have exited their 9-5 jobs to work entirely online.

Blogging has proven to be one of the profitable digital marketing ideas that’s worth switching to.

But before you quit your main job to blogging, it’s essential you understand its earning potential and the time it takes to start earning.

Since blogging is not one of those get-rich-quick schemes, I wouldn’t suggest replacing your full-time job with it from day one.

Instead, you should make blogging your side hustle at the moment and gradually replace it with your main job when you start earning up to your current salary or more.

However, if you’re unemployed and are looking for a quick way to make money online, consider these 15 legit ways to make money fast in Canada.

Hopefully, now you know how to make money blogging in Canada. If you need more clarification, hit me up in the comment section below. 

FAQs on How to Make Money Blogging in Canada

How much do bloggers earn in Canada?

It depends on the niche and the monetization method employed. However, according to, Canadian bloggers earn an average of $78,000 annually. Beginners earn $37,050 annually and expert bloggers earn up to $126,200 annually in Canada.

Do I need to register my blog as a business in Canada?

You don’t need to register a blog as a business in Canada. But if you’re looking to give your blog a legal outlook, there’s nothing wrong with registering your blog in Canada.

Are bloggers taxed in Canada?

Yes. Bloggers are taxed by the Canada Revenue Agency (CRA) using the self-employment tax rate. 

How do I start a free blog and make money in Canada?

You can start a free blog and make money in Canada by signing up with WordPress, Blogger, Wix or other free blogging platforms. 

Note that using a free blogging platform can limit your earning potential. But you can start with a free platform and migrate to a paid platform in the future.

What qualifications do you need to be a blogger?

There are no formal qualifications to begin a blog. The major requirement is to have passion and funds for your blog domain name and hosting registration. 

But to be successful in blogging, you need good writing skills, originality, creativity, patience, and consistency.

Photo of author

About John Adebisi

John Adebisi is a CPA, FCCA and MBA holder with a Bachelor's degree in Accounting & Finance. He has over a decade of experience in writing personal and business finance content for audiences across North America, Europe, the UK and Africa. In addition to his writing experience, he also has a strong background in financial research and analysis, giving him a unique perspective of the financial markets. John derives pleasure in helping people make smart financial decisions, and he believes that knowledge and experience can be valuable resources for anyone who wants to learn how to manage their money.

Leave a comment